Beneath the Surface: Secondary Hyperparathyroidism (sHPT)
Chronic kidney disease, which results when kidneys become damaged and can’t filter waste or properly balance fluids or minerals, affects approximately 26 million American adults, many of whom require dialysis. Many of the approximately 2 million people throughout the world who are on dialysis will also develop secondary hyperparathyroidism (sHPT), a chronic and serious disease which is frequently underdiagnosed.
